Other names for a state diagram are state machine diagram or state chart diagram.Įlements of a state diagram Predefined primitive types State diagrams can also be used to express the usage protocol of part of a system. Please note that you can add multiple sequence diagrams to your model by creating new ones, but it is not possible to copy a sequence diagram to create a new one.Įlements of a sequence diagram State diagramĪ state diagram is a behavior diagram that shows discrete behavior of a part of a designed system through finite state transitions. A sequence diagram shows different processes or objects that live simultaneously (shown in parallel vertical lifelines), and the messages exchanged between them in the order in which they occur (shown as horizontal arrows). It describes the interaction between objects in the sequential order that these interactions occur. Use cases are often refined into one or more sequence diagrams.Įlements of a use case diagram Sequence diagramĪ sequence diagram is an interaction diagram. Package diagrams are useful when class diagrams that encompass the whole system become too large.Įlements of a package diagram Use case diagramĪ use case diagram is a dynamic behavior diagram that describes a set of actions (use cases) that some system or systems should or can perform in collaboration with one or more external users of the system (actors). A package diagram is just a class diagram that shows only packages and dependencies. It shows the packages of classes that make up the model, and the dependencies between the packages. It describes the static structure of a system by imaging the classes of the system, their attributes, operations (or methods) and the relationships between the classes.Įlements of a class diagram Package diagramĪ package diagram is a static structure diagram.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|